AI实时语音合成的实现步骤详解

在人工智能飞速发展的今天,语音合成技术已经成为了一个备受关注的热点。AI实时语音合成作为一种将文字转换为语音的技术,具有广泛的应用前景。本文将详细阐述AI实时语音合成的实现步骤,带领大家深入了解这项技术的魅力。

一、了解实时语音合成的背景和意义

  1. 背景介绍

随着科技的进步,语音合成技术得到了迅猛发展。实时语音合成作为一种新兴技术,具有以下特点:

(1)响应速度快:能够实时地将文字转换为语音,满足用户快速获取信息的需求。

(2)准确性高:能够准确地合成语音,使语音听起来更加自然、流畅。

(3)适用范围广:可以应用于各类场景,如智能家居、智能客服、在线教育等。


  1. 意义

(1)提高工作效率:实时语音合成技术可以帮助人们更快速地获取信息,提高工作效率。

(2)拓展应用领域:实时语音合成技术可以应用于更多领域,如智能家居、智能客服等,推动产业升级。

(3)改善用户体验:实时语音合成技术可以为用户提供更加人性化的服务,提升用户体验。

二、实时语音合成的实现步骤

  1. 文字预处理

(1)分词:将输入的文字按照语义进行分割,得到一个个具有独立意义的词语。

(2)声学模型:将分割后的词语映射到对应的音素,为后续的语音合成提供音素序列。


  1. 音素合成

(1)查找音素:根据声学模型,从音素库中查找与音素序列相对应的音素。

(2)合成语音:利用声学模型和语音编码技术,将音素序列合成语音。


  1. 语音增强

(1)消除噪声:通过降噪技术,降低语音中的噪声成分。

(2)提高音质:通过语音增强技术,提高语音的音质,使语音听起来更加自然。


  1. 语音输出

(1)音频输出:将合成后的语音输出到扬声器或其他音频设备。

(2)文字输出:将合成后的文字输出到显示屏或其他显示设备。

三、实时语音合成的关键技术

  1. 语音识别

语音识别是实时语音合成的基础,其主要任务是识别输入的文字。关键技术包括:

(1)声学模型:将音频信号映射到声学特征,如梅尔频率倒谱系数(MFCC)。

(2)语言模型:根据声学特征和上下文信息,对输入的文字进行解码。


  1. 语音合成

语音合成是将文字转换为语音的过程,其主要任务是生成具有自然、流畅语调的语音。关键技术包括:

(1)声学模型:将音素序列映射到音频信号。

(2)语音编码技术:将音频信号转换为数字信号,便于传输和处理。


  1. 语音增强

语音增强技术可以降低语音中的噪声,提高语音质量。关键技术包括:

(1)噪声消除:利用自适应滤波等技术,消除语音中的噪声。

(2)语音增强:利用语音增强算法,提高语音质量。

四、实时语音合成的应用场景

  1. 智能家居

(1)语音助手:用户可以通过语音助手控制家居设备,如空调、电视等。

(2)语音报警:当家居设备出现故障时,可以通过语音报警提醒用户。


  1. 智能客服

(1)自动问答:用户可以通过语音提问,智能客服可以自动回答问题。

(2)语音转文字:将用户语音输入的文字转换为文字,便于记录和回复。


  1. 在线教育

(1)语音讲解:教师可以通过语音讲解,使学生在听的同时学习。

(2)语音交互:学生可以通过语音与教师或系统进行交互,提高学习效果。

总结

实时语音合成技术作为人工智能领域的一个重要分支,具有广泛的应用前景。本文详细阐述了实时语音合成的实现步骤、关键技术及应用场景,希望能为广大读者提供有益的参考。随着技术的不断发展和完善,实时语音合成技术将为我们的生活带来更多便利。

猜你喜欢:AI语音聊天